Q: Is 2,920,740 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,920,740 is a composite number.

Why is 2,920,740 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,920,740 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 30 60 48,679 97,358 146,037 194,716 243,395 292,074 486,790 584,148 730,185 973,580 1,460,370 and 2,920,740, with no remainder.

Since 2,920,740 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,920,740, it is a composite number.
